Bloodfist 2050 (2005)

To avenge his brother's death, Alex Danko must enter the erotic and deadly criminal underground of the near future, where he finds the fight of his life !

Bloodfist 2050 (2005) poster

Alex Danko descends into the ultra-violent underworld of extreme martial-arts to find his brother's killer with the help of hardened Detective Ramirez and his brother's alluring ex-lover in this post-apocalyptic allegory of greed and revenge set in in 2050 Los Angeles.
